From Two Prongs to Four: The Evolution of the Fork Believe it or not, the fork wasn't always the multi-pronged wonder we see today. In ancient times, forks only had two prongs and were primarily used for cooking or serving food. It wasn't until the Middle Ages that the fork started to gain popularity as a dining utensil. As the fork made its way across Europe, it began to take on different shapes and sizes. Some forks had three prongs, while others had four. The design of the fork continued to evolve, with different regions putting their own unique spin on this essential tool. Fork Etiquette: The Rise of Table Manners With the increasing popularity of the fork, a new concept emerged: table manners. People started to pay more attention to how they ate, using forks to delicately pick up their food instead of using their hands. The fork became a symbol of refinement and sophistication. By the 18th century, forks had become a staple at dining tables across Europe. Different types of forks were used for different types of food, from meat to dessert. Fork etiquette became an important part of social gatherings, with people judged on their ability to wield this tiny tool with grace. Fork Lore: Myths and Legends Throughout history, the fork has been surrounded by myths and legends. In some cultures, it was believed that using a fork would bring bad luck or even death. Others saw the fork as a symbol of wealth and status, reserved only for the elite. One famous legend tells the story of a Venetian noblewoman who introduced the fork to Italy after marrying a Byzantine prince. The Italians were scandalized by her use of the fork, but she persisted, eventually popularizing this revolutionary utensil across the country.
